The concept of intuitive design is highlighted as crucial for player experience. It suggests that players should not have to spend time figuring out how to interact with the interface; instead, actions should feel natural and instinctive. This involves clear menus, obvious buttons, and a logical flow for all interactions, aiming to reduce friction for the user.
